Why Sharp Tools Matter

You wouldn’t tackle a loaf of fresh bread with a dull knife, so why battle your garden with blunt tools? Sharp pruners make cleaner cuts, helping plants heal faster. A well-honed shovel slices through the soil like a dream, and keeping your hoe razor-sharp means fewer weeds and less strain on your back.

The Secret to Restoring Your Garden Tools

Before you throw out that rust-coated trowel, let’s talk about a few easy ways to bring it back to life. A little effort now saves a small fortune down the road.

  • Scrub Away Rust: An old wire brush or a splash of vinegar will take care of stubborn rust. Let metal tools soak in a vinegar bath overnight, then give them a good scrub.
  • Sharpen Those Edges: A mill file or whetstone is all you need to get those blades back in business. Work in one direction, following the original bevel.
  • Oil for Protection: Metal rusts fast when left exposed. A light coat of linseed or mineral oil keeps oxidation at bay.
  • Wood Handles Need Love Too: Sand down rough spots and rub in a bit of boiled linseed oil to prevent cracking.

When It’s Time to Upgrade

Sometimes, no amount of sharpening will bring an old tool back to life. If the handle is cracked, the blade chipped, or if tightening the bolts no longer helps, it’s time to invest in new gear.
